Basalt fiber is a material formed from very fine basalt fibers made up of plagioclase, pyroxene, and olivine minerals. Basalt fiber is made by melting crushed and washed basalt rock at a temperature of over 1,500°C (2,730°F). Basalt fiber has a wide range of applications in both military and civilian settings. For example, basalt fiber can be utilized to make protective apparel for both hot and low temperatures. Basalt fiber is employed in a variety of sectors and applications, including building and infrastructure, due to its environmentally benign properties, excellent compatibility with concrete, and ease of mixing at high concentrations. It also has high strength and recyclability, which contributes to its widespread use in a variety of industries. In addition, it does not necessitate the use of any specific processing equipment.

Basalt fibers are in great demand due to the growing usage of lightweight composite materials in the fabrication of automobile components and aircraft bodies. Crushed basalt rock is melted in a furnace to create basalt fibers. This manufacturing process is environmentally safe, as it produces no damaging infrared radiation. Because of their better tensile, thermal, and other qualities, basalt fibers have been widely used as a replacement for traditional steel and other fiber reinforcements.

Basalt Fiber Market Drivers:

Basalt fibers have superior mechanical strength, chemical and heat resistance, insulation, and other qualities than other fibers. Due to a number of features such as corrosion resistance and lightweight, basalt fibers are increasingly being utilized as an alternative to steel reinforcements. This enables mounting without the requirement of lifting or other specialist equipment, which further propels the global basalt fibers market during the forecast period.

In construction composites, basalt fibers also outperform e-glass fibers. Basalt fibers have superior breaking load capacity, durability, and stiffness in all forms, including roving, chopped strands, and textiles. In addition, basalt fibers are less expensive, and obtaining raw materials is rather simple. Therefore, because of all of the aforementioned advantages, basalt fibers are likely to see an increase in demand throughout the forecast period. The firms are concentrating on creating alternative low-cost basalt fiber production processes. As a result, new manufacturing facilities are expected to open in the future years. Non-corrosive products are in high demand in the construction industry since they help to save costs and extend the life of structures constructed with them. One of these advancements is the use of corrosion-free basalt fiber composite bars as concrete reinforcement. Basalt composites are non-corrosive, made up of 80% fibers, and have three times the tensile strength of steel bars commonly used in construction. The rebar is strengthened by the basalt fibers, which are held in place by the resin. When compared to steel rebar, BFRP (basalt fiber reinforced plastic) rebar extends the life of civil engineering constructions when corrosion is a significant problem. Therefore, these factors tend to increase the global basalt fibers market share in the next six years.

Basalt Fiber Market Restraints:

Basalt fibers have a few obstacles to overcome when it comes to producing basalt fibers. For example, only a few areas in Eastern Europe have the grade and chemical composition of basalt rock essential for the creation of basalt fibers. As a result, even though the raw material is inexpensive, it must be imported. Furthermore, the initial setup and equipment costs are relatively substantial and necessitate a significant capital commitment, providing a significant barrier for producers. Basalt fiber is commonly employed in infrastructure and building projects. Despite the fact that basalt fiber has superior qualities to E-glass and S-glass fiber, it is not widely used in commercial applications. Basalt fiber has a lot of potential in the maritime, automotive, transportation, aerospace, defense, sporting goods, and wind industries. However, because of a lack of understanding regarding basalt fiber's applications, glass fiber remains the preferred material. Therefore, these factors hamper the global basalt fibers market during the forecast period.

During the forecast period, continuous form held a significant share of the basalt fiber market in terms of both value and volume.This rapid expansion is mostly due to increased demand from the building and infrastructure sectors. Continuous basalt fibers have advantages like greater efficiency, stronger tensile strength, and improved mechanical properties. Continuous basalt fiber is also environmentally friendly, making it appropriate for various applications, including reinforcing nets, pipelines, containers, electrical insulation materials, basalt plastic goods, and so on. They also have a higher strength than steel, making them a popular choice in the building business.
